Course Content

• Humanitarian Principles and Law
• Protection Monitoring Methodologies and Techniques
• Data Collection, Analysis, and Reporting (including GIS)
• Protection Needs Assessment and Risk Analysis
• Conflict Sensitivity and Do No Harm Principles
• Information Management and Communication for Protection
• Advocacy and Humanitarian Protection Strategy
• Capacity Building and Training in Protection Monitoring

Career path

Career Role Description
Humanitarian Protection Monitoring Officer Lead investigations, analyze data, and prepare reports on protection risks for vulnerable populations in the UK. Requires strong analytical and reporting skills.
Senior Protection Monitoring & Evaluation Specialist Design and implement monitoring and evaluation frameworks for humanitarian protection programs. Requires experience in data analysis, program design, and international development.
Protection Monitoring & Research Analyst Conduct research, analyze data, and produce reports on trends in humanitarian protection challenges. Excellent analytical, research, and writing skills are essential.
Humanitarian Protection Coordinator (UK Focus) Coordinate protection activities, manage teams, and liaise with stakeholders. Requires leadership, communication, and experience with UK-based humanitarian programs.
